ASSESSMENTS AND EXAMS ETHICS AND PROFESSIONAL LEGAL PRACTICE MODULE: • 30-minute, multiple choice open book exam on legal method • Graded essay (2,000 words) on an ethical dilemma FOUNDATION MODULES: • Seven, three-hour closed book exams - one for each foundation module CHOOSE FROM: RESEARCH PROJECT MODULE: • Extended essay (4,500 words) on your chosen area of law OR LAW OF ORGANISATIONS MODULE: • Legal report (2,000 words) on an allocated problem based question
